Regular Pricing Structures



Comprehending just how drywall pricing is structured can aid you budget successfully for your job. The majority of drywall service providers bill based on the square video of the location to be covered. You'll usually find prices ranging from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, depending upon factors like material quality and labor know-how.



Some contractors might likewise supply a per-sheet price, which typically drops between $10 and $15 per drywall sheet (4x8 feet). If you're working with a larger task, you might find that professionals are open to working out bulk discount rates.

Along with standard prices, watch out for prices variations based upon the project's intricacy. For instance, if your wall surfaces call for detailed layouts or you require to set up drywall in hard-to-reach areas, anticipate to pay a premium.

It's likewise worth considering whether the quote includes completing, such as taping, mudding, and sanding, as this can dramatically affect the overall cost.
